Legends of Tomorrow Season 4 Episode Guide and Reviews

Here's everything you need to know about Legends of Tomorrow season 4!

Legends of Tomorrow Season 4 brought us even more offbeat superhero action than we’ve already come to expect. We’ve got everything you need here in one place for you.

Legends of Tomorrow Season 4 Episodes

Legends of Tomorrow Season 4 Episode 1: The Virgin Gary

After the Legends defeated Mallus and wiped the final anachronism from time, they find themselves in unfamiliar territory with the Time Bureau. All that changes when Constantine (Matt Ryan) informs Sara (Caity Lotz) of a new magical threat that leads the team to Woodstock. Constantine thinks he knows how to defeat the new threat, but will need the help of the team and their special klepto talents to help with his spell. Meanwhile, Nate (Nick Zano) and Rory (Dominic Purcell) go on an adventure leaving Nate facing someone from his past. Brandon Routh, Tala Ashe, Jes Macallan and Courtney Ford also star.”

air date: 10/22/18

Read our review of the Legends of Tomorrow season 4 premiere.

Ad – content continues below

Legends of Tomorrow Season 4 Episode 2: Witch Hunt

“When the magical Time Seismograph goes off, the team finds themselves headed to the Salem witch trials.  Sara (Caity Lotz) notices that Zari (Tala Ashe) is taking this case personally when she promises to save a mom, who is being accused of being a witch. However, the team quickly learns that there is a magical creature in the town creating problems they hadn’t been expecting. Meanwhile, Nate (Nick Zano) and Ava (Jes Macallan) work together to try to keep their Time Bureau funding by proving to them that magic exists.”

air date: 10/29/18

Read our review of “Witch Hunt” here.

Legends of Tomorrow Season 4 Episode 3: Dancing Queen

“When the Legends discover a fugitive is hiding in 1970’s London, they realize he is part of a gang that is targeting the British Monarchy. Trying to stop the gang, they realize someone from the Legends must infiltrate them. Surprising everyone, Ray (Brandon Routh) is the one to gain their trust after he is put through a series of tests with help from Sara (Caity Lotz) and Rory (Dominic Purcell). Meanwhile, Gary (guest star Adam Tsekhman) shows Nate (Nick Zano) the ropes at the Time Bureau, but it turns out to be anything other than an ordinary day at the office.”

air date: 11/5/18

Read our review of “Dancing Queen” right here.

Ad – content continues below

Legends of Tomorrow Season 4 Episode 4: Wet Hot American Bummer

When the Legends discover that kids at a summer camp have disappeared, Sara (Caity Lotz), Ava (Jes Macallan), Ray (Brandon Routh) and Constantine (Matt Ryan) find themselves as the new camp counselors.  At camp, Ava struggles to get along with the kids, but Constantine whips up a potion that helps Sara and Ava bond with the children. Luckily, the team finds clues to the whereabouts of the missing kids, but the battle to save them leaves one member in bad shape.  Meanwhile, Rory (Dominic Purcell) and Zari (Tala Ashe) are tasked with watching the fugitive and Rory finds a kindship with their “prisoner.” Maisie Richardson-Sellers also stars.”

air date: 11/12/18

Read our review of “Wet Hot American Bummer” right here.

Legends of Tomorrow Season 4 Episode 5: Tagumo Attacks!!!

A new fugitive is on the loose in 1951 Tokyo and Sara (Caity Lotz), Zari (Tala Ashe), Rory (Dominic Purcell) and Charlie (Maisie Richardson-Sellers) try to capture it.  As Constantine (Matt Ryan) struggles to recover, Ray (Brandon Routh) knows that magic might be the only thing that can save him but must look outside the team for help.  Meanwhile, Ava (Jes Macallan) joins Nate (Nick Zano) and his family for an unconventional Thanksgiving dinner.”

air date: 11/19/18

Read our review of “Tagumo Attacks!!!” here.

Ad – content continues below

Legends of Tomorrow Season 4 Episode 6: Tender is the Nate

When Hank Heywood (guest star Tom Wilson) confronts Ava (Jes Macallan) about the spending habits of the Legends, Nate (Nick Zano) steps in to try and smooth things over by inviting Hank on to the Waverider.  The Legends then show Hank what they do by visiting 1920s Paris, trying to capture the newest Fugitive. Meanwhile, Mona (Ramona Young) is trying to make a good impression with Ava, but her over eagerness gets her and Ava stuck in a cell instead.”

air date: 11/26/18

Read our review of “Tender is the Nate” here.

Legends of Tomorrow Season 4 Episode 7: Hell No, Dolly

With Rory (Dominic Purcell) and Ava (Jes Macallan) at odds, Sara (Caity Lotz) tries to come up with a way for them to get along, but all is put on hold when a new magical creature attacks the Legends.  Constantine (Matt Ryan) is forced to confront his tragic past but it could have devastating consequences for the rest of the team. Meanwhile, Mona (Ramona Young) has a crush on someone she works with and gets some advice from Nate (Nick Zano).”

air date: 12/3/18

Read our review of “Hell No, Dolly” here.

Ad – content continues below

Legends of Tomorrow Season 4 Episode 8: Legends of To-Meow-Meow

After Constantine (Matt Ryan) breaks the cardinal Legend rule, you can’t change the past, he, along with Charlie (Maisie Richardson-Sellers) and Zari (Tala Ashe) try to deal with the ramifications without telling the rest of the Legends. Even though Zari encourages them to just fix the problem, Constantine and Charlie are determined to find another way, but only continue to make things worse.”

air date: 12/10/18

Read our review of “Legends of To-Meow-Meow” here.

Legends of Tomorrow Season 4 Episode 9: Lucha de Apuestas

“When the Legends hear that Mona (Roman Young) has let a fugitive go, they must head to 1961 Mexico City to clean up her mess. Mona tries to convince the Legends and the Bureau that the people responsible for releasing the fugitive were some mysterious Men in Black and not her. With no evidence to back up her theory, the Legends must decide if they should trust her and go against the Bureau. Meanwhile, Nate (Nick Zano) and Zari (Tala Ashe) go on a recon mission to find out what Hank (guest star Tom Wilson) might be hiding from everyone.”

air date: 4/1/2019

Read our review of “Lucha da Apuestas” here.

Ad – content continues below

Legends of Tomorrow Season 4 Episode 10: The Getaway

When Hank (guest star Tom Wilson) commandeers the Waverider in 1973, the Legends find themselves on the run in an RV after kidnapping the President who is only able to tell the truth.  With the help of Constantine (Matt Ryan), they discover the reason that none of them can lie making for an uncomfortable family road trip.  Meanwhile, Nate (Nick Zano) and Zari (Tala Ashe), with the help of Nora (Courtney Ford) and Gary (guest star Adam Tsekhman), work together to find out what Hank is really up to.”

air date: 4/8/2019

read our review of “The Getaway” here.

Legends of Tomorrow Season 4 Episode 11: Seance and Sensibility

“When Mona discovers that her favorite author, Jane Austen, might be at the epicenter of a magical alert, Mona, Sara, Charlie and Zari find themselves in 1809. With Nate still dealing with family issues, Constantine and Rory perform a séance and receive a message from the other world that rocks Constantine to his core. Meanwhile, Ray and Nora are forced into close quarters.”

air date: 4/15/2019

Read our review of “Seance and Sensibility” here.

Ad – content continues below

Legends of Tomorrow Season 4 Episode 12: The Eggplant, The Witch, and The Wardrobe

With darkness on the rise in 2019, the team realizes that a new host of problems have risen as they have been cleaning up history.  Sara (Caity Lotz) tries to save Ava (Jes Macallan) from a fate worse than death while battling her own demons.  Nora (Courtney Ford) and Constantine (Matt Ryan), work together to take down a powerful demon. Meanwhile, Zari (Tala Ashe) gets unsolicited advice from Mona (Ramona Young), Charlie (Maisie Richardson-Sellers) and even Rory (Dominic Purcell).” 

air date: 4/22/2019

Read our review of “The Eggplant, the Witch, and the Wardrobe” here.

Legends of Tomorrow Season 4 Episode 13: Egg MacGuffin

While Ray (Brandon Routh) is worried about Nora (Courtney Ford), he is suddenly faced with his own problem that forces him to do the unthinkable.  Nate (Nick Zano) and Zari (Tala Ashe) are stuck in an awkward limbo, so Sara (Caity Lotz) devises a plan to send them on an easy mission together. Meanwhile, Charlie (Maisie Richardson-Sellers) and Rory (Dominic Purcell) are approached with a lucrative offer that could upend their lives.  Jes Macallan, Matt Ryan and Ramona Young also stars.”

air date: 4/29/2019

Read our review of “Egg MacGuffin” here.

Ad – content continues below

Legends of Tomorrow Season 4 Episode 14: Nip/Stuck

“When Sara (Caity Lotz) hesitates to make a tough call, Rory (Dominic Purcell) steps up creating a wedge in the team. Meanwhile, Ava (Jes Macallan) gives Gary (guest star Adam Tsekhman) the responsibility of handling the Bureau performance reviews for all the Agents.”

air date: 5/6/2019

read our review of “Nip/Stuck” here.

Legends of Tomorrow Season 4 Episode 15: Terms of Service

With things getting out of control, Sara (Caity Lotz) and Ava (Jes Macallan) concoct a bold plan to take back the Time Bureau. But when things go awry, Zari (Tala Ashe) and Charlie (Maisie Richardson-Sellers) must work together to discover what Neron is planning. Elsewhere, Constantine (Matt Ryan), is given a tough choice on who to save from Hell.”

air date: 5/13/2019

read our review of “Terms of Service” here.

Ad – content continues below

Legends of Tomorrow Season 4 Episode 16: Hey, World!

While on a mission to find Ray (Brandon Routh), Constantine (Matt Ryan) and Nora (Courtney Ford) discover Neron’s evil plan. Nate (Nick Zano) convinces the Legends to think outside the box and suggests a dangerous plan to unite magical creatures and people to save the world.”

air date: 5/20/19

read our review of “Hey, World!” right here.

And we’ll see you in 2020 for Legends of Tomorrow Season 5!

Legends of Tomorrow Season 4 Cast

Sometimes fan patience pays off. It remains one of the great injustices of our current golden age of superhero television that Constantine only ran for one season on NBC. Despite a fan campaign to make a second season happen, it wasn’t to be. But you simply do not waste a ridiculously perfect piece of casting like Matt Ryan as John Constantine. Ryan’s Constantine has since returned to work his dark magic on Arrow and Legends of Tomorrow. He has his own animated series, too.

Adding Constantine to the team makes perfect sense. Legends has long been a kind of “island of misfit toys” for cool, slightly displaced characters, and it’s known for swapping up its roster with abandon. This season in particular has been a busy one in that regard. But the current season’s focus on magic and demons has meant that we’ve heard Constantine’s name come up several times, even when he hasn’t actually shown up. If he’s going to be around for every adventure next year, that might be a sign they’re considering other stories where having a magic specialist around will be necessary. 

Ad – content continues below

The bad news is that Keiynan Lonsdale won’t be back as Wally West/Kid Flash after the season premiere. He might show up occasionally after that, but he’s no longer a series regular. We have some more details on that right here.

However, we can expect much more of Nora Dahrk this season. Deadline broke the news that Courtney Ford will now be a series regular.

Maisie Richardson-Sellers will also return!

Ramona Young (BlockersSanta Clarita Diet) joins the cast in the series regular role of Alaska Yu. A typical twentysomething easily swept up by romantic notions and fantasy novels, she’s something of an expert in the world of the magical creatures that the Legends encounter in season four. In the company of the Legends, she soon learns to get her head out of the clouds to become a kickass superhero.

Tom Wilson (The InformantBack to the Future, The Mayor) will recur as Nate’s father, Hank Heywood. With a lifetime in the military and Dept. of Defense, Hank is part of a long line of Heywoods to serve the country. Charming and charismatic, he’s left big shoes for Nate to fill — and it doesn’t help that Nate can’t tell him he’s secretly a Legend!

Legends of Tomorrow Season 4 Story

Here’s the official synopsis for Legends of Tomorrow Season 4:

After defeating the demon Mallus by cuddling him to death with a giant stuffed animal named Beebo, the Legends are ready to ease off the gas. Sara (Caity Lotz) and her team join Ava Sharpe (Jes Macallan) and the Time Bureau to help clean up the last few remaining anachronisms. The job seems straightforward enough until Constantine (Matt Ryan) arrives to inform them that, in solving one major problem, they have created another, much larger one. When the Legends let time crumble in order to release and defeat Mallus, the barrier between worlds softened. History is now infected with “Fugitives” – magical creatures from myths, fairytales, and legends. Having been expelled throughout time by people like Constantine, these Fugitives are now returning to our world in droves and making a real mess of things. As the Time Bureau is distrustful of and ill-equipped to deal with magic, the Legends must team up with everyone’s favorite demonologist to set history back on track.

Sara and Constantine are joined by compassionate inventor Ray Palmer (Brandon Routh), hotheaded ex-con Mick Rory (Dominic Purcell), rebellious totem-bearer Zari (Tala Ashe), and heartbroken historian-turned-superhero Nate (Nick Zano) as they set out to save the world – and their legacy. It’s the familiar fun of the Legends time-travelling across historical events and encountering famous figures with an added shot of magical craziness! 

We’ll update this with more info as soon as we have it.

Ad – content continues below

Mike Cecchini is the Editor in Chief of Den of Geek. You can read more of his work here. Follow him on Twitter @wayoutstuff.